Output 268a96b0dec288c90806af23f98cdab71aac81b32c3f74876e115938546fef3b:5

value
10223640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f49cd26317b80f18391935880bf35254c45d0dd2 OP_EQUAL
address
AEjfQNHNqLKDu4RgwsbFYHdduerzSyAuWH
transaction
268a96b0dec288c90806af23f98cdab71aac81b32c3f74876e115938546fef3b